IN THE MATTER OF JOHN HOGAN, PETITIONER, v. DEPARTMENT OF CORRECTIONS AND COMMUNITY SUPERVISION, BRIAN FISCHER, ALBERT PRACK, M. SHEAHAN, J. COLVIN, T. LEVAC, D. WILLIAMS, M. THOMS, CENTRAL NEW YORK OFFICE OF MENTAL HEALTH AND JOHN DOES 1 THROUGH 4, RESPONDENTS.


PRESENT: , SMITH, CENTRA, FAHEY, AND PERADOTTO, JJ.

Petitioner having moved to vacate the dismissal of this CPLR article 78 proceeding transferred to this Court by order of the Supreme Court entered in the Office of the Clerk of the County of Seneca on May 8, 2013, and having moved for other relief,

Now, upon reading and filing the affidavit of John Hogan sworn to September 16, 2014, and the notice of motion with proof of service thereof, and due deliberation having been had thereon,

It is hereby ORDERED that the motion insofar as it seeks to vacate dismissal of this proceeding is denied, and the motion is otherwise dismissed.

Memorandum: Petitioner's motion insofar as it seeks to vacate dismissal of this proceeding is untimely (see 22 NYCRR 1000.13 [g]).

Entered: October 15, 2014

Frances E. Cafarell, Clerk
